Nearly 100 policemen desert police outpost

By Surya Bishwakarma

PYUTHAN, April 25 - In a rare show of the kind, nearly a hundred
policemen deserted a remote police outpost at Devisthan village on
Wednesday night and fled towards Bijubar village after locals tipped them
off about the movement of underground Maoist rebels in the area and an
impending attack on the post.

The mass desertion of the policemen came despite orders to the contrary by
their senior officers. After receiving information about the movement of
rebels in surrounding Miram, Nayagaon and Ramdi VDCs Wednesday evening, the
officers persuaded the policemen to remain on duty, but to no avail. 

The junior police staff chose to desert the outpost rather than wait for
reinforcements, knowledgeable sources said. Then their senior followed
suit. The cops boarded a local bus and reached Bijubar at 8 p.m. Wednesday
night. With nowhere to go, they could be seen loitering on the street
itself, eyewitnesses said.
